Provider Score in 38941, Itta Bena, Mississippi

The Provider Score for the COPD Score in 38941, Itta Bena, Mississippi is 25 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

An estimate of 86.16 percent of the residents in 38941 has some form of health insurance. 46.81 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 45.14 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ase. Military veterans should know that percent of the residents in the ZIP Code of 38941 have VA health insurance. Also, percent of the residents receive TRICARE.

For the 968 residents under the age of 18, there is an estimate of 0 pediatricians in a 20-mile radius of 38941. An estimate of 1 geriatricians or physicians who focus on the elderly who can serve the 499 residents over the age of 65 years.

In a 20-mile radius, there are 360 health care providers accessible to residents in 38941, Itta Bena, Mississippi.

## COPD Score Analysis: Itta Bena, MS (ZIP Code 38941)

Analyzing the availability of quality COPD care in Itta Bena, Mississippi (ZIP code 38941) requires a multi-faceted approach. We must consider not only the number of physicians but also their specialization, the availability of advanced diagnostic and treatment options, and the integration of supportive services like mental health care. This analysis provides a COPD Score assessment for primary care physicians within the specified area, focusing on key indicators of accessibility and quality.

The physician-to-patient ratio is a critical starting point. While specific data on the exact number of primary care physicians (PCPs) practicing directly within the 38941 ZIP code is difficult to obtain without proprietary datasets, publicly available resources, and local health reports provide valuable insights. The Mississippi State Department of Health, along with the US Census Bureau, can offer population data and physician distribution estimates. This information is crucial to understanding the potential burden on existing PCPs. A low physician-to-patient ratio, indicating fewer doctors per capita, suggests a greater challenge in accessing timely care, potentially exacerbating COPD management. The ratio should be compared to the state and national averages to assess the relative availability of care in Itta Bena.

Beyond sheer numbers, the types of practices and their resources play a significant role. Are there well-established primary care clinics within the ZIP code? Are they equipped with the necessary diagnostic tools, such as spirometry machines for lung function testing? Do they have dedicated respiratory therapists on staff, crucial for patient education and management? The presence of these resources directly impacts the quality of COPD care. Furthermore, the availability of pulmonologists, specialists in lung diseases, is essential. While PCPs often manage stable COPD, access to pulmonologists is vital for complex cases, exacerbations, and advanced treatment options. Proximity to specialists in nearby towns like Greenwood or Indianola becomes a crucial factor in assessing the overall care landscape.

Telemedicine adoption is another crucial factor. In rural areas like Itta Bena, telemedicine can bridge geographical barriers, improving access to care. Are local practices utilizing telehealth platforms for virtual consultations, medication management, and remote patient monitoring? Telemedicine can be particularly beneficial for COPD patients, allowing for regular check-ins, symptom monitoring, and early intervention, potentially preventing hospitalizations. Practices that embrace telemedicine demonstrate a commitment to patient-centered care and improved accessibility.

Mental health resources are often overlooked in COPD management, but they are integral. COPD can significantly impact mental well-being, leading to anxiety, depression, and social isolation. The availability of mental health professionals, such as therapists and psychiatrists, who specialize in chronic illness is essential. Does the local primary care clinic offer integrated behavioral health services? Are there referrals to mental health providers within the community? The integration of mental health care into COPD management improves patient outcomes and overall quality of life.

The quality of COPD care is also impacted by the availability of patient education and support groups. Does the local clinic offer educational programs about COPD management, including medication adherence, breathing techniques, and lifestyle modifications? Are there support groups where patients can connect with others, share experiences, and receive emotional support? These resources are critical for empowering patients to manage their condition effectively.

Further, the quality of care is also influenced by the availability of emergency services. The proximity of a hospital with a specialized respiratory unit is crucial for managing COPD exacerbations. The response time of emergency medical services (EMS) to patients experiencing breathing difficulties is also critical. The overall healthcare ecosystem plays a role in the care of COPD patients.
